Assistant Store Manager - Auckland
We are looking for an enthusiastic and capable candidate for the Assistant Store Manager's position to autonomously manage the day-to-day operations of our busy store. It is a Full-time role working minimum 30 hours per week.
You would be required to perform the following duties not limited to- Contribute to team effort by accomplishing related results as needed.
- Assist the manager to make a full list of all stock, maintain stock levels and determine how popular an item is before ordering new stock
- Receiving and checking orders from suppliers to ensure accuracy.
- Ensure correct and accurate invoicing of ordered products.
- Assist the manager to review and compare prices of competitor stock and ensure that stock is competitively priced.
- Ensure stock is properly priced and displayed.
- Balancing the till and managing day to day banking and financial transactions.
- Answer the company phone in a friendly and engaging way.
- Meet and greet customers and state that they can ask you for further assistance if necessary.
- If necessary, help customers to choose items, advising of any promotions and then accurately collecting payments at the counter.
- Communicating with customers to review the quality of products and service and noting any questions or concerns they may have.
- Dealing with customer complaints in a satisfactory way.
- To look and suggest opportunities to improve procedures,
- Assist in managing stock levels and making key decisions about stock control and pricing, including implementing stock control systems, stock tracking, purchasing.
- Serving customers, advice and recommend products and add on products
- Follow up on customer complaints/comments quickly and forward them to the store manager promptly
- Identify current and future customer requirements by establishing rapport with potential and actual customers and other persons in a position to understand service requirements.
- Ensure availability of merchandise; determining and maintaining stock levels.
- Ensure Occupational Health and Safety requirements are adhered to
- Maintain professional and technical knowledge
